7K - $92K a year Overview:
The estimator will be responsible for analyzing bid specifications, subcontractor quotes, and drawings in the preparation of an Electrical project specific bid.
Bi-Con Services employees working in safety-sensitive positions are drug and alcohol tested under the federal DOT regulations.
Testing is conducted for pre-employment, on a random basis (according to the requirements of DOT), reasonable suspicion and post-accident (according to the requirements of DOT.
) Under DOT regulations, marijuana, whether with a medical prescription or not, is considered an illegal substance.
Responsibilities:
Attend pre-bid meetings as necessary.
Review proposal specifications and drawings to determine scope of work and required contents of estimate.
Identify subcontractor needs for specific bids.
Prepare subcontractor RFQ packages for bid purposes.
Complete construction take-offs for bid preparation utilizing estimating software.
Obtain and evaluate subcontractor quotes for the evaluation.
Prepare material RFQ packages for bid purposes.
Research historical data (purchase orders, subcontracts, job cost reports, etc.
) for bid purposes.
Maintain historical data and estimating units.
Maintain files of working documents as backup for estimate figures.
Attend bid evaluation meetings and communicate basis for bid details.
Attend pre-job planning meetings.
Provide estimating support to other divisions as required.
Provide assistance to project managers as necessary.
Provide assistance to field crews as necessary.
Other duties as assigned.
Qualifications:
4-year degree or equivalent combinations of technical training and/or related experience required.
2
years construction estimating, engineering or similar experience preferred.
General knowledge of estimating techniques, cost control and material pricing required.
Ability to calculate mathematical extensions, read and understand engineering drawings, purchase orders, contracts, cost coding systems, etc.
is essential.
Detail-oriented, organized and ability to multi-task in a high-volume, deadline driven environment.
Excellent problem solving, time management and decision-making skills.
Proficiency with MS Office Suite (Word, Outlook, Excel, PowerPoint).
Excellent communication skills; verbal, written and interpersonal.
Work will involve being in an office setting and field work.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
